❖ Auto Image Density Priority
You can set whether Auto Image
Density is “On” or “Off” when the
machine is turned on, reset, or
modes are cleared.
Note
❒ Default:
• Text: On
• Drawing: On
• Text/Photo: On
• Photo: Off
• Background Lines: On
• Patched Original: On
• Generation Copy: On

❖ Copy Quality
Adjusts the finish for each original
type (Text, Drawing, Text/Photo,
Photo, Background Lines, Patched
Original, Generation Copy).
Note
❒ [Custom Setting]: Your service
representative will set this to
meet your requirements. For
details, consult your service
representative.
• Text
Adjusts line and character out-
line quality in the copy image.
Note
❒ Default: Normal
❒ Character outline is less de-
fined when [Soft] is selected;
more defined when [Sharp] is
selected.
• Drawing
Adjusts the line density and
lighter sections of image.
Note
❒ Default: Normal
❒ Originals that have light pen-
cil lines can be reproduced
with greater clarity when
[Soft] is selected. When
[Sharp] is selected, pencil
lines can be reproduced
clearly with improved clari-
ty.
• Text / Photo
You can select to prioritize the
copy image of “Text” or “Pho-
to” when copying originals con-
tain photographs and the text.
Note
❒ Default: Normal
❒ When [Normal] is selected, an
original containing a mixture
of text and photographs can
be reproduced.
• Photo
You can configure the machine
to copy originals with photo-
graphs.
Note
❒ Default: Print Photo
❒ Select [Print Photo] when cop-
ying originals with photo-
graphs such as magazines or
catalogues. A smooth finish
image can be reproduced.
❒ Select [Glossy Photo] when
copying developed photo-
graphs. The text contained
within the photographs can
be reproduced appropriate-
ly.
